Huaiyang Longhu is located in the hinterland of Huanghuai Plain, with a width of 4.4 kilometers from east to west and a length of 2.5 kilometers from north to south. The dike 14 kilometers, with an area of 1 1 square kilometer (16483) and a water area of more than 8,000 mu. Its momentum and scale have overshadowed Hangzhou West Lake and Wuhan East Lake. The lake surrounds the ancient city, which stands in the water; There is a city in the lake, and there is a lake in the city. It is known as the inland wonder, formerly known as Pearl.
Longhu is rich in fish, mainly carp, crucian carp, bream, snakehead, catfish, Pelteobagrus fulvidraco, snakehead (snakehead, snakehead), herring, grass carp and silver carp, among which carp is the most famous and has a long history. As early as the Spring and Autumn Period, Longhu carp was well known. Book of Songs. There was a poem "You can stay under Chen Feng's door late, but you can't eat fish and swim like carp". At that time, Longhu carp was as famous as Yellow River carp. According to the Records of Huaiyang County, in the twelfth year of Yang Di the Great (AD 6 16), carp was found in the female wall of the county, which was more than 7 feet long.
Huaiyang custom, carp symbolizes good luck. When men and women become matchmakers, they must invite them to eat big carp. Wedding banquets, birthday banquets and braised carp are indispensable dishes, especially when the elderly are 73 and 84 years old, children must buy live carp, so that the old birthday star can see it first and then taste it, and wish the elderly a long and healthy life. Huaiyang carp is nutritious and delicious, with a meat yield of over 70%, a protein content of 18.5% and a fat content of 4.6%. It also contains a variety of vitamins and trace elements, and has medicinal and nourishing effects.
